JavaScript 是一種腳本語言,它的變量類型包含了數字、字符串、布爾值、對象等多種類型。在JavaScript 中,整型變量為 Number 類型,它可以表示正數、負數、0,還可以進行數學計算,如加減乘除等。下面我們來看一些例子。
聲明一個變量并賦值:
var num1 = 10; console.log(num1); //輸出:10
使用運算符進行計算:
var num2 = 20; var sum = num1 + num2; console.log(sum); //輸出:30
也可以使用字符串和數字進行運算:
var str = "10"; var sum = num1 + str; console.log(sum); //輸出:1010
需要注意的是,JavaScript 中的數字類型沒有整型和浮點型的區別,所有數字都被視為 Number 類型。以下是一些其他的例子:
當數字太大或太小時,可以使用科學計數法來表示:
var bigNum = 1e6; //相當于 1000000 var smallNum = 1e-6; //相當于 0.000001 console.log(bigNum); //輸出:1000000 console.log(smallNum); //輸出:0.000001
可以使用 parseInt() 和 parseFloat() 方法將字符串轉換為數字:
var strNum1 = "10"; var strNum2 = "10.5"; var num1 = parseInt(strNum1); var num2 = parseFloat(strNum2); console.log(num1); //輸出:10 console.log(num2); //輸出:10.5
需要注意的是,當字符串中出現不能被解析為數字的字符時,這兩個方法會返回 NaN:
var str = "abc"; var num = parseFloat(str); console.log(num); //輸出:NaN
以上是 JavaScript 中整型變量的定義和使用方法的說明。需要注意的是,由于 JavaScript 中沒有整型和浮點型的區別,因此對于一些需要高精度計算的場景需要使用其他庫來完成。